What is Double Glazing?
Double glazing describes a window style that includes 2 panes (or sheets) of glass separated by an area filled with gas (typically argon) or a vacuum. This style creates an insulating barrier that decreases heat loss, minimizes condensation, and decreases energy expenses.
Common Issues with Double Glazing
Regardless of its advantages, double glazing glass installation glazing is not immune to concerns. Some common problems include:
Foggy or Cloudy Windows: Often resulting from a damaged seal, wetness can get in the space between panes, resulting in condensation.Broken or Cracked Glass: Impact or severe climate condition can result in breaks or fractures in the glass.Deteriorating Seals or Frames: Over time, the seals can degrade, and frames may need repair work or replacement due to rot or damage.Operational Failures: Over time, windows may not open or close effectively due to problems with hinges, locks, or the frame.Benefits of Double Glazing Repair

1. The length of time does double glazing repair take?
Repair times can differ based upon the level of the damage but generally vary from a couple of hours to a few days.
2. Is it much better to repair or change double-glazed windows?
Oftentimes, repairing is more economical and less disruptive than changing windows, especially if just seals or glass need attention.
3. How can I inform if my double-glazed windows need repairs?
Common signs include visible condensation in between panes, draftiness, problem opening/closing, or damage to the frames.
4. What is the average cost of double glazing repair?
Expenses can range substantially depending upon the nature of the repair, with easy seal replacements normally costing less compared to full glass replacements.
5. Can I repair double glazing myself?
While minor issues may be manageable, it is frequently advisable to engage a professional to guarantee a high requirement of workmanship.
